Large floral wood carving by wood carvers of Tamil Nadu of Krishna as Venugopala. This is a 6 feet tall wood carving of Krishna Venugopala carved out of single block of wood.
The wood carving is very intricately carved and detailed. It is on the lines of floral and flowing designs as seen in Carnatic wood art. Every inch of this fantastic wood sculpture of Venugopala is carved with utmost care and the carving is as clean as found in stone carvings of temples in Halebidu and Belur.
This is a wood carving of four-armed Venugopala form of Krishna in which he is seen poised playing flute in his lower hands. His upper hands hold shankha (conch) and chakra (disc), the attributes of Lord Vishnu whose eight incarnation Krishna was. The figure of Krishna is carved with detailed jewellery and a beautiful garland around his neck and shown wearing a tall, rich crown.
